#4b4831 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4b4831 is composed of 29.4% red, 28.2% green and 19.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 4% magenta, 34.7% yellow and 70.6% black. It has a hue angle of 53.1 degrees, a saturation of 21% and a lightness of 24.3%. #4b4831 color hex could be obtained by blending #969062 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

Shades and Tints of #4b4831

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040402 is the darkest color, while #faf9f7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#4b4831

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#41413b is the less saturated color, while #7b6d01 is the most saturated one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#4b4831 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#464646 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#474642 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#56503b Protanopia 1% of men
  • #5e4d3c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#574e53 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#524d37 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#574b38 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#534c47 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
